On Tue, Nov 05, 2024 at 11:26:15AM -0300, Arnaldo Carvalho de Melo wrote:
> From: Arnaldo Carvalho de Melo <acme@redhat.com>
> 
> As suggested by Namhyung for the "import perf" python binding test, skip
> the tests that require perf being linked with libtraceevent, telling the
> reason:
> 
>   $ make -C tools/perf NO_LIBTRACEEVENT=1
>   # perf check feature libtraceevent
>          libtraceevent: [ OFF ]  # HAVE_LIBTRACEEVENT
>   # ldd ~/bin/perf | grep traceevent
>   #
>   # perf test
>     1: vmlinux symtab matches kallsyms                 : Ok
>     2: Detect openat syscall event                     : Skip (not linked with libtraceevent)
>     3: Detect openat syscall event on all cpus         : Skip (not linked with libtraceevent)
>     4: mmap interface tests                            :
>     4.1: Read samples using the mmap interface         : Skip (not linked with libtraceevent)
>     4.2: User space counter reading of instructions    : Skip (not linked with libtraceevent)
>     4.3: User space counter reading of cycles          : Skip (not linked with libtraceevent)
> <SNIP>
>    14: Parse sched tracepoints fields                  : Skip (not linked with libtraceevent)
>    15: syscalls:sys_enter_openat event fields          : Skip (not linked with libtraceevent)
> <SNIP>
>    32: Track with sched_switch                         : Skip (not linked with libtraceevent)
> <SNIP>

It doesn't look good we need #ifdef every places.  Is it possible to
check it as an integer value and return early if it's not available?

	if (!HAVE_LIBTRACEEVENT)
		return TEST_SKIP;

I guess it'd break where it just checks if it's defined.  Probably we
need a separate global variable to be set using the value.

Obviously it cannot be applied if it needs to see the definition of
data type in the libtraceevent.  But I think encapsulated things
already.
